Patrick Fridenson is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, History and History and Philosophy of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Patrick Fridenson has authored 103 papers receiving a total of 660 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 31 papers in History and 18 papers in History and Philosophy of Science. Recurrent topics in Patrick Fridenson’s work include French Historical and Cultural Studies (29 papers), French Urban and Social Studies (22 papers) and Historical Studies and Socio-cultural Analysis (18 papers). Patrick Fridenson is often cited by papers focused on French Historical and Cultural Studies (29 papers), French Urban and Social Studies (22 papers) and Historical Studies and Socio-cultural Analysis (18 papers). Patrick Fridenson collaborates with scholars based in France, Italy and United States. Patrick Fridenson's co-authors include Hidemasa Morikawa, Antoine Prost, Alfred D. Chandler, Jacques Mairesse, Madeleine Rebérioux, Albert Carreras, Takashi Hikino, Jeffrey Fear, Geoffrey Jones and Harm G. Schröter and has published in prestigious journals such as The American Historical Review, British Journal of Sociology and The Economic History Review.
